Cannot extract elements from a scalar

WebJun 24, 2015 · There are rows in the table containing a scalar value in column medicines instead of array. You should inspect and properly update the data. You can find these rows with this query: select id, medicines from appointment where jsonb_typeof(medicines) <> … WebSubstring search on JSON data (ERROR: cannot extract element from a scalar) Ask Question Asked 6 years ago Modified 6 years ago Viewed 661 times 0 I've been looking …

postgresql - How to turn JSON array into Postgres array?

WebJun 17, 2024 · cannot extract elements from a scalar. You can try one of these (instead of jsonb_array_elements (t.addresses) address ): jsonb_array_elements ( case … WebI've got a 300GB postgres DB that I'm currently backing up like this: First I run: pg_dump --format=tar, which just outputs to a local disk in the system 2. Then I use Restic to upload to Backblaze B2 object storage, along with the rest of regular backups of other files on the system. I've outgrown using pg_dump, it takes too long for 300GB (and it's likely to grow). date night ideas for couples nyc https://firstclasstechnology.net

Substring search on JSON data (ERROR: cannot extract …

WebWhat I am trying to to is the following: select jsonb_array_elements (jsondoc_->'BlockData')->>'Name' from BlockData; What I get in return is "ERROR: cannot extract elements from a scalar SQL state: 22024" From what I could discover is that this issue occurs because at some rows the return is NULL. WebERROR: cannot extract element from a scalar PostgreSQL’s -> operator is generally pretty good at soaking up null references. You can chain it on a nested object and it’ll … WebJul 11, 2024 · malformed array literal - PostgreSQL. json array is not self castable to postgres array. You need to either properly parse and cast it ( json_array_elements, unnest, array_agg ), or use some monkey hack, like: UPDATE survey_results SET areas = concat ( ' {' ,translate (raw#>> ' {areas}', '"' ,$$ '$$ ), '}' ):: text []; above I "prepare" json ... bixby samsung como desativar

sql - PostgreSQL extract keys from jsonb, exception "cannot call …

Category:sql - PostgreSQL extract keys from jsonb, exception "cannot call …

Tags:Cannot extract elements from a scalar

Cannot extract elements from a scalar

Using the value of a JSON object that is stored in a PostgreSQL …

WebApr 7, 2024 · I'm unable to extract field 'Short Sleeves'. Below is the query i'm using: Select JSON_EXTRACT (style_attributes,'$.attributes.Sleeve Length') as length from table; The query fails with the following error- Invalid JSON path: '$.attributes.Sleeve Length' For fields without ' ' (space), query is running fine. WebSep 10, 2024 · 报错: > ERROR: cannot extract elements from a scalar 原因: content 有错误数据,加条件去掉错误数据即可。 select id, jsonb_array_elements (content) from "fd_content_behavior_at_2WIQRCZAPA" where content:: text != 'null' 或者 select id, jsonb_array_elements (content) from "fd_content_behavior_at_2WIQRCZAPA" where …

Cannot extract elements from a scalar

Did you know?

WebAug 6, 2013 · Update: I found these two posts here and here that indicate it should work exactly as I am doing. Just to be sure I tried this: postgres=# select * from jtest where data ->> 'k2' = 'two'; ERROR: cannot extract element from a scalar Is there a build option or contrib module I need to get JSON functionality? postgresql-9.3 Share Improve this …

WebApr 13, 2024 · You can extract the string value from the scalar, then cast that string into a jsonb. #>>' {}' will extract the string out of a scalar. select jsonb_array_elements ( … WebJun 8, 2015 · Tour Start here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ies of this site

WebJul 10, 2024 · SELECT jsonb_object_keys (table.column) as a FROM "table" This threw an error: cannot call jsonb_object_keys on a scalar So, to check the column type (which I … WebSELECT x.* from the_table, jsonb_array_elements (jsonbrecords) AS t (doc), jsonb_to_record (t.doc) as x ("grade" text, "userId" text, "endYear" int, "startYear" int); Now for the actual question. The error can be avoided by not using jsonb_to_record and accessing each key individually instead:

Webcannot extract elements from a scalar-postgresql score:12 Accepted answer You can try one of these (instead of jsonb_array_elements (t.addresses) address ):

WebJun 25, 2024 · ERROR: cannot extract elements from a scalar db<>fiddle here. You might avoid the exception with a nested CASE like:... LEFT JOIN jsonb_array_elements( … date night ideas fresnoWebJul 28, 2024 · This works nice but for some weird reason, I still get cannot extract elements from a scalar if I use my column name instead of null. FuzzyTree about 6 years. @norbertpy forgot to address that - you will have to convert the column value to an json array because both arguments in the coalesce must return a json array bixby samsung removal on tvWebfrom django.db import connection with connection.cursor() as cursor: cursor.execute("select id from mytable, jsonb_array_elements(details) as detail_elements;") rows = cursor.fetchall() but I get this error: psycopg2.errors.InvalidParameterValue: cannot extract elements from a scalar date night ideas fort myers floridaWebAug 6, 2013 · According to section 9.15 of the manual, the -> operator should access elements of a JSON data type. It looks to me like although the info schema says the … bixbys brunchWebselect jsonb_array_elements (jsondoc_->'BlockData')->>'Name' from BlockData; "ERROR: cannot extract elements from a scalar SQL state: 22024". From what I could discover … date night ideas for parents at homeWeb1 day ago · I was wondering what the most efficient way is to extract a single double element from an AVX-512 vector without spilling it, using intrinsics. double extract (int idx, __m512d v) { __mmask8 mask = _mm512_int2mask (1 << idx); return _mm512_mask_reduce_add_pd (mask, v); } I can't imagine that this is a good way to do it. bixby scannerWebSELECT json_array_contains(' [1, 2, 3]', 2); Copy to clipboard. json_array_get(json_array, index) → json. #. Warning. The semantics of this function are broken. If the extracted element is a string, it will be converted into an invalid JSON value that is not properly quoted (the value will not be surrounded by quotes and any interior quotes ... bixby samsung download